Additional QuickBooks Bill Pay Features

  • Make payments to any company or individual in the United States1
  • Establish internal business controls for creating, reviewing and sending payments
  • Authorization levels dictate who has access to your accounts
  • Final payments are sent only when you release them, and are protected with a password (PIN) issued only to you
  • Aggregate multiple invoices or bills from a single vendor into one payment
  • Include invoice & credit memo details with payments to obtain proper credit from vendors
  • Automatic entry of transactions into your QuickBooks register means no need for duplicate data entry to maintain a record of your transactions
  • Schedule payments in advance to take advantage of favorable payment terms2
  • Make payments from up to 10 different accounts at no additional cost
  • Create a stored payee list so you only have to enter your vendor information once
  • Print images of checks and file with invoices for detailed record-keeping
  • Request a stop payment at any time prior to your specified delivery date

How It Works

Write checks as you normally would in QuickBooks. Instead of selecting "To be Printed", select "Online Bank Payment" and choose the date on which you would like the payment to be delivered.

OR

Pay bills as you normally would in QuickBooks. Select "Online Bank Payment" and choose the date on which you'd like the payment to be delivered.

THEN

Send the payments from the Online Banking Center within QuickBooks, and the payments will be made by the delivery date. (when setting delivery date, allow up to 4 business days for processing)

Pricing

QuickBooks Bill Pay is FREE for the first month.3 After your free trial, the service is $15.95 per month for up to 20 payments, and $6.95 for each additional set of 10 payments.

Security

Protecting the security of your financial information is a priority. Your online payment instructions are sent using a secure Internet connection and SSL encryption technology, and protected with a password (PIN) issued only to you.

Your electronic payments are sent through our online payment processor, who offers a guarantee of protection against delays and unauthorized transactions.4
